Understanding the health concerns and care needs of Australian Shepherds

by newsbitbox.com

australian shepherds, also known as Aussies, are known for their intelligence, agility, and loyalty. These beautiful and energetic dogs are popular pets for many people around the world. However, like all breeds, Australian Shepherds have their own set of unique health concerns and care needs that owners should be aware of in order to ensure their furry friend lives a happy and healthy life.

One of the most common health concerns for Australian Shepherds is hip dysplasia. Hip dysplasia is a genetic condition that causes the hip joint to develop abnormally, leading to arthritis and pain. This can be especially common in larger breeds like Australian Shepherds, so it’s important to keep an eye on your dog’s mobility and watch for any signs of discomfort when they are walking or running.

Another health concern for Australian Shepherds is hereditary cataracts. This is a condition in which the lens of the eye becomes cloudy, leading to vision impairment. Cataracts can be surgically removed in some cases, but it’s important to catch them early in order to prevent further damage to your dog’s eyesight.

Epilepsy is another common health concern for Australian Shepherds. Epilepsy is a neurological disorder that causes seizures, which can be scary for both the dog and the owner. If your Australian Shepherd has epilepsy, it’s important to work closely with your veterinarian to develop a treatment plan to help manage the seizures and keep your dog safe.

Australian Shepherds are also prone to developing certain skin conditions, such as allergies and hot spots. Allergies can be triggered by a variety of factors, including food, pollen, and environmental irritants. Hot spots are areas of irritated and inflamed skin that can be caused by allergies, infections, or over-grooming. Regular grooming and a healthy diet can help prevent these skin conditions in Australian Shepherds.

In addition to these health concerns, Australian Shepherds also have specific care needs that owners should be aware of. Australian Shepherds are a high-energy breed that require plenty of exercise and mental stimulation in order to stay happy and healthy. Daily walks, runs, and playtime are essential for keeping your Aussie physically and mentally fit.

Australian Shepherds are also highly intelligent and trainable, so it’s important to provide them with consistent training and mental challenges to keep their minds sharp. Obedience training, agility courses, and puzzle toys are all great ways to keep your Australian Shepherd engaged and entertained.

Proper grooming is also important for Australian Shepherds. Their thick double coat requires regular brushing to prevent matting and reduce shedding. Bathing should be done as needed, but be careful not to overdo it, as frequent baths can strip the natural oils from your dog’s coat.

Regular veterinary check-ups are essential for Australian Shepherds in order to catch any potential health issues early. Vaccinations, heartworm prevention, and dental care are all important aspects of keeping your Aussie healthy and happy.
